Hisar hottest at 42.2 degree Celsius

May 05, 2011 12:50 am | Updated 12:50 am IST - Chandigarh:

Hisar braved yet another hot day at 42.2 degree Celsius as most parts of Haryana and neighbouring Punjab continued to experience the scorching heat for the third consecutive day on Wednesday.

The maximum at Hisar was three degrees above normal level, the MeT department said here. Ambala and Karnal also had a hot day, recording maximum of 40.1 degree and 40 degree respectively.

In Punjab, sweltering heat prevailed in Amritsar, which recorded a high of 41.7 degree, up by five notches.

Ludhiana recorded a high of 40.7 degree, up three degrees, while Patiala was even hotter at 41.2 degree, up four notches.
